FOO’s scope evolves around the Internet of Things (IoT) and wildlife habitats. To illustrate our datasets of interest, we modelled the concept to represent “sensors observing animals and land”. These sensors generate observations. For example, the animal GPS collar tracks an elephant and records its geo-location observations for different and equally spaced time intervals and temperature every specified time interval. We adopted classes and properties from SOSA and BBC wildlife ontologies to model the domain coverage.
